XiFin recognized as top RCM partner for cross-ancillary and outpatient laboratory services in 2025 Black Book Survey
XiFin, Inc. announced that it has been ranked the #1 client-rated RCM partner for cross-ancillary and outpatient laboratory services for the seventh consecutive year in Black Book Market Research’s 2025 RCM Outsourcing Survey. XiFin also earned the #1 ranking in outpatient radiology and diagnostic imaging RCM for the second consecutive year.
The 2025 survey incorporated validated feedback from 3,275 healthcare executives, revenue cycle leaders, and clinical operations professionals, evaluating vendor performance across 18 operational, technology, and service-delivery criteria that impact reimbursement, compliance, and financial sustainability.
XiFin was recognized for utilizing AI across the revenue cycle to help healthcare providers improve first-pass clean claims, accelerate cash flow, and reduce administrative burden. XiFin’s AI-driven RCM capabilities support laboratories, radiology groups, pharmacies, medical device organizations, and other outpatient service providers by:
- Predicting denial risk by analyzing code combinations, payor policies, eligibility discrepancies, and historical payment behavior
- Evaluating claim completeness, flagging documentation discrepancies, and predicting the likelihood of reimbursement
- Managing large volumes of documentation and correspondence inherent in RCM, thereby reducing expensive manual oversight
- Surfacing documentation gaps, clarifying payor requirements, and estimating patient responsibility with high accuracy—helping prevent denials and reducing bad debt
